Introduction to the Ukraine-Russia Conflict

The conflict between Ukraine and Russia has dominated global news since 2014, following Russia’s annexation of Crimea. This ongoing dispute is critical not only for the countries involved but also for international politics, energy security, and humanitarian issues. As tensions continue to simmer, understanding the latest developments becomes essential for citizens and policymakers alike.

Recent Developments

As of October 2023, the war in Ukraine has intensified, with reports indicating increased military activity in the Donbas region. Ukrainian forces and Russian-backed separatists engaged in heavy fighting, leading to significant casualties on both sides. The Ukrainian government announced earlier this month the launch of a new counteroffensive aimed at reclaiming territories lost in the conflict.

Internationally, Western nations have provided ongoing support to Ukraine, with military aid packages continuing to flow from the United States and European allies. Recent discussions in NATO have reinforced commitments, and additional sanctions on Russia were agreed upon following fresh evidence of war crimes in Ukraine. Meanwhile, Russia has continued its militarisation efforts near the border, raising concerns about potential escalations.

Humanitarian Impact

Humanitarian efforts are becoming increasingly critical as millions of Ukrainians have been displaced from their homes. Aid organisations are struggling to meet the needs of those affected, particularly in conflict zones. According to estimates from the United Nations, over 8 million people have been internally displaced, with many seeking refuge in neighbouring countries.
